Comic Con 2008
Well, most of Saturday was spent wandering the vast spaces of the Javits Center in Manhattan. I had never been to a comics expo before, so I did not know what to expect. First of it was massive, hoards of people everywhere, the only way to move through the crowd was to push and shove your way as if were the mosh pit at a crazy rock show. I also, did not realize how many people I would personally know with booths set up. I find these folks truly inspiring. I managed to snap some pics with me and some of this talent that I speak of:
